A communication gap is caused when others perceive us in a assorted way  we meant  them to.

The fact is, that the first notion is the strongest one. Even unconsciously, people will look for a proof  to verify and justify their gut feeling.

So, since we don\’t get a second chance to make the first impression, and since assorted occasions demand assorted looks, we better be aware of the various styles, learn what they project, and put this message in action.

 

 Before we decide on  the image  we want to convey, it is important to insist on three factors:

 

1. The appurtenances should be appropriate to the time and place :

    For example, a mini touch that reveals toned legs, should be saved for a ethnic occasion.

    A Polo shirt should be worn during vacation time.

 

2. The call should be consistent and continual :

    You wouldn\’t  want  to project  authority and  reliability on one day, and  appear dishelved                                  

   on the next.

 

3. The assorted pieces of the appurtenances will be of the same call :

    A watch with a rubber band will clash with the suit.

    A impressible pen will look out of place in  a  dress-shirt\’s pocket.

We\’re talking about four main styles. Each one of them conveys a  unique  and different  message:

The artist style, the sporty style,  the dramatic,  and the romantic style.

 

 

The artist Style 

 

The appearance.

When we watch people who are dressed in the artist style, we immediately have a scenario in our head regarding their personality.

They look mature, sincere, respectable, trust worthy, authoritative, self control, powerful, and thinkers. The strength look as belonging to the high society, substantially educated, financially substantially off, and in a senior-position in the corporate.

The artist call people strength also appear to be formal, conservative, keeping distance, non- adventurous.

In order to send this image, here are some suggestions:

 

The wardrobe.

Silhouette -   should be straight and in place. Not puffed, not floaty.  Covering the vast area of the body.

Fabrics -  cotton, blended cotton, wool, ( cool wool for season ), blended wool,                                                                                              gabardine,   silk, ( a women\’s blouse ). 

Texture -   should be smooth.

Pattern -   solid, pine stripe, herringbone, very subtle geometric design.

Colors -   black, white, gray, navy blue, pine green, taupe ( gray emancipationist ), burgundy,

               dark  brown, ivory, beige, icy pink, icy violet, and other icy colors.

Suites -  from the above options, not too tight,  not too loose.

Jacket -   lightly padded shoulders, diminutive region line, not too high arm holes, single, threefold or no vent.

Trousers -   should be pleated, creased, mistreated or not.

Shirt -   Should be in uncolored colors. Long sleeves, accepted collar, accepted or button  down collar. One pocket or none.

Blouse -   avoid any see through fabrics, avoid any decolte\’, can be tucked in or out.

Dress/Skirt -   should fall straight down, not shorter than the knees, not longer than the calf.

Tie -   made of silk, solid, stripe, dot, paisley, foulard ( diminutive geometrical continual design).

Socks -   solid, or with a diminutive ankle design.

Hosiery -   winter and summer.

Belt -   high quality leather, solid color, uncreased texture, coordinate with shoes or pants.

Man Shoes -   lace up.

Woman Shoes -   flat or up to 5 centimeter heel.

Accessories:

Watch -   good quality, preferably non digital.

Gloves -   thin leather.

Handkerchief -   cotton or linen.

Pen -   metal, not plastic,  designed

Jewelry -   silver, gold, pearls, bottom design.

Briefcase -  square lines, diminutive combination locks, good quality leather.

Bag -   firm, solid design.

Hair -   neat and tidy, away from the face.

Make Up -   minimal: light eyes shadow, eyeliner, soft lipstick.

Elegant Bridal Gowns: What to Look For

Tuesday, July 13th, 2010

This year, the watchword in wedding gowns is “elegance”. Pure, drop-dead, delicious elegance. Whether the look is contemporary, traditional or high couture, the overall see on the wedding runways is unmistakable, it’s a return to la Belle Epoch, a world of chic elegance and graceful, dramatic silhouettes. Here’s what to be on the lookout for if you’re shopping for a wedding gown in the Spring/Summer 2009 season.

Asymmetrical Lines

Asymmetry is definitely in this season, but that doesn’t mean that the look is lopsided. The elegance is in the details and the execution. One of the most elegantly lopsided dresses for Spring 2009 is Priscilla of Boston’s Style 1408, a stunning one-shoulder ball gown that features a draped bodice and lopsided waistline to balance the lopsided neckline. The effect is just as lovely from the back as it is from the front with the modify waist echoing the diagonal of the one-shouldered bodice.

Silhouettes

The most prominent silhouette in this season’s range of elegant wedding gowns is the “fit-to-flare”, a cut that is ingratiating for most figures. The coiffe is cut to fit the torso, and then flares below the hip into a wide swirl. The most exaggerated fit-to-flare cut is the trumpet flare, which starts slim and swirls into a ground-sweeping flare at the floor. added very ingratiating silhouette for your big day is the A-line dress, a classic wedding gown shape that fits closely at the bodice, and then flares out softly to the hem. Perhaps the most elegant wedding gown for a formal, traditional wedding though, is the ball gown, which combines a fitted bodice with a bell-like skirt. The Platinum Collection makes great use of the ball gown to create elegant couture looks in unusual and unexpected fabrics and styles.

Necklines

Sweetheart bodices, once considered the eventual in elegance for fairy tale weddings, now hit a lot of competition. Some of the most elegant equal wedding gown styles feature strapless bodices, often fanned or pleated. Many of the popular wedding gown styles feature truelove necklines modified to work with a strapless design. One shoulder lopsided designs are added elegant option for the equal bride, especially if the lopsided look is balanced by fullness at the hem or a contrasting imbalance at the waist.

Pleated Bodices

Fan-pleated bodices are added wedding gown feature that you will see walking down the runway at the most elegant designer Spring shows. Strapless, fan-pleated bodices aren’t right for everyone, but they’re an eye-catching accent for the bride who isn’t overly endowed. Not all folding is fanned, however. Some of the prettiest and most elegant designs feature ruched bodices and flat bands of folding crossways the bodice, or vertically pleated satin and taffeta.

Hem Treatments

Hems are also getting the pleated treatment, along with flounces and tiers of lace. Some of the most elegant hem treatments include trumpet flares edged with alter or flounced with ruched netting. From the Vineyard Collection, the Ivy wedding coiffe model is the eventual in eventual elegance, a fitted cover coiffe of cloth and organza that features bands of satin detailing at the bodice and the hem.

Materials

The materials utilised to make a wedding gown are one of the major factors in determining the cut and the drape of the dress. The most elegant styles are those that move and flow with your body. Fabulous fabrics for wedding dresses include cloth in its many variations, including shantung and charmeuse. Other materials that are traditionally utilised in elegant wedding gown design include organza, satin and tulle, but one of the most elegant designs of this season is a eventual fit-to-flare gown made in chiffon and lace. The Holly, from the Vineyard Collection, features spaghetti straps, alter over chiffon and a flared skirt with insets of net that create an elegant sweep.

Lace

One of the most utilised laces in wedding gown design is Alencon lace, sometimes called the Queen of Lace. This embroidered alter is handmade, and highly prized for the dustlike needlework of the cording that makes up the designs. Alencon alter is often embellished with beading and metallic thread. Other alter that may be utilised in elegant wedding designs include Battenburg alter and metropolis lace. handstitched European lace, sometimes called Princess lace, may also be utilised in net overlays or for wedding veils.

Important Things to Remember

Elegance is often in the eye of the beholder, but there are a few key things to advert when choosing the right wedding gown for you.

1. naivety is often more elegant than fancy details.
2. Quality of materials and workmanship is essential. opt the finest materials and workmanship that you can afford.
3. Elegance is a matter of fit. Be sure to hit your gown fitted properly to you so that you see overconfident and beautiful in it. modify the simplest gown is elegant when it’s carried off with confidence.

Advice for the Big and Tall Male to Upgrade His Look in Comfortable Attire

Wednesday, March 10th, 2010

Big and tall clothes aren’t ever the most stylish, while smaller clothes never seem to fit right. But, it is possible to be a big or tall man (or both)and still dress and look stylish. To find out how, keep reading.

Skip the Too-Big and Baggy Look

Fabric that flaps and sways in the wind is rarely attractive. Now, imagine six and-a-half feet of that fabric draping and hanging. To refrain looking same a tall drape or curtain, meet away from covering that’s too baggy. Instead, follow with clothes that fit.

It’s rattling common, specially for tall men, to simply buy the biggest size they can find, hoping that it would be long enough. meet believing that and you’ll be wearing moo-moos for the rest of your life.

Don’t dress it Too Tight

Unfortunately, too dripless is just as bad, if not worse, as too baggy. On the tall man, covering that is too snug would make his height and slim frame more pronounced. On the big and tall man, the rattling same type of covering would accentuate all the features that he wants to downplay. Instead, choose clothes that fit.

Opt for flat Lines or Plaids

On a tall man, vertical lines act as an elongation device, extending his torso and making him appear taller and large than he already is. Tall men should look for shirts with small plaids and flat stripes, unless you’re a big and tall man. In that case, refrain flat stripes and instead follow to tiny patterns and dark colors.

Wear a broad Rise Pant

Unless you’re buying your pants in a specialty height store, you should ever be buying high-rise pants. Big and tall men often have problems with the crotch of their pants being too short or too small. refrain all that uncomfortable bunching and twisting by buying pants with a higher rise that fits you through the crotch.

Double Check the Break of Your Pants

The break of your pants is where the bottom hits your shoe. Ideally, your pants should fall loosely and easily on to your shoe, without revealing your ankles or socks. You may find that when you sit down, your pants would rise up, but this is common for everyone.

Choose a Flat-Fronted Pant

Particularly if you’re big and tall, pleated trousers would only accentuate any player weight around the midsection. Instead, opt for a flat front garment as an primary element of your big and tall clothes closet. These are also a good fit for tall men in general as pleats can actually unsubdivided the leg, making a man appear modify taller.

Tall men or those who are large are frequently self-conscious about their height and weight. For those who would same to de-emphasize those features as conception of their overall appearance, it is important to be cautious concerning the types and fit of covering they wear. Gentlemen who learn to do this substantially look great.

Antique Lamps for the English Look

Sunday, March 7th, 2010

In the world of inland design, the â??English Look” has never been out of fashion, with comfortable, slightly worn, eclectic interiors. 

The shack would be a kinda mixed style with the contents of furniture, rugs and accumulated collections having been assembled over generations with artifacts brought bag from India, Africa and other parts of the old British Empire.

The look, in general, would hit a kinda â??shabby chicnessâ? about it, although entirely pleasing to the eye, inviting and comfortable.  furnishings would not hit perfect finishes; rugs would be a mixture of oriental, the emblem of which hit daylong since faded to pastels.  The walls, with the look full blown, would be crammed with paintings, prints, porcelain and pottery, mirrors and faded family photos all hanging on warm and friendly wallpaper, the windows draped with curtains of floral printed fabrics.

The ideal English look must hit a fireplace for cold winter days and nights, with polished brass fire irons, fire screen and shaped fender, all gleaming in the fire light.

In addition, there are the lamps! and many of them!  Beautiful lamps would grace every table & sideboard.  Classic lamps with sumptuous, silk shade treatments such as knife and box pleating, shedding soft reddened around a shack all aglow.
